I have owned this Bay Area work-horse since April 22, 1999 and I am the 3rd owner. I bought it with salvaged title (See #2 below regarding title) with 169,012 miles on odometer. I have used it as my daily driver during the last 20 years (average mileage comes to (7291.5 miles/year).
For regular maintenance/basic repairs it has been primarily cared for by Waylon @ Toy Shop, and Hans @ Hans Art. Gary @ Mudrak has overseen more intensive care issues such as front end rebuild, carb rebuild, and cylinder valve job., clutch replacement, and as source for body parts.
Truck comes with original owner’s manual and service records (including some from previous owner) July 1996 to August 2019.

Asking price is based on two factors:
#1 There is outer roof rust along the roof rain gutters, front passenger front door edge, and top of windshield pillars. For the last 2 years I have arrested rust, primed, and sealed tight with 3” Gorilla tape (change out every 6 months) and no interior leaks have ever occurred. There are some very minor body dings but otherwise the body and frame/underside are in very good rust-free condition.

#2 on May 2 2018 I was hit by a jetlagged tourist in San Francisco who took out original hood, passenger side fender, head/turn signal light bucket and lens, running lights, front bumper & front grille. My lousy insurance would not pay for body shop repair. I have since sourced and replaced all damaged body and accessory parts from Mudrak and put everything back together. It drives totally straight and has no known frame damage. I have had it aligned, Brake and Light Safety Inspected, passed CHP Certificate of Inspection (CHP 97C), and re-registered it with new plates as a “Revived Salvaged Vehicle Title” . I continue to drive it daily, albeit with a 3-tone paint scheme.
